Easy Pumpkin Curry, serves two. Mince the garlic and finely chop the onion. Sauté in the oil or ghee for 3-4 minutes until softened and fragrant. Add the coconut milk, pumpkin puree, and all the spices except for salt and pepper. Whisk together and cook over medium heat until everything is warmed through.
